The National Monuments Service's description

On fairly a fairly level karst landscape on the S bank of a W-E stream. An area of about 25 acres (c. 10 ha) contains numerous shallow quarries (dims c. 10m x c. 10m; D 0.2-0.5m) and the remnants of a field system defined by earth and stone banks (Wth c. 2-3m; H 0.2-0.5m). The rath (RO028-194001-) is within the area but probably pre-dates the field walls. The fields are large and curvilinear (dims c. 70m x c. 50m), but towards the E end there is a complex of smaller rectangular fields (dims c. 20m x c. 10m). There is no evidence of cultivation ridges, and the house sites (RO028-194002-; RO028-194003-; RO028-194005-) are associated with it.
